Two killed in shack shooting near railway in Acornhoek
One man was found with gunshot wounds and later died in hospital.
Two men, aged 26 and 37, were fatally shot in Acornhoek on Tuesday, June 10.
According to the Mpumalanga police spokesperson, Lieutenant Colonel Jabu Ndubane, preliminary investigations revealed that five armed men stormed into a shack near a railway line and fired shots before they fled the scene using two vehicles, an Audi and a Toyota Fortuner.
The police discovered one of the victims lying on the ground with multiple gunshot wounds. The second, believed to be a friend, was found with gunshot wounds and was transported to a local hospital where he later died.

“The motive behind the killing remains unclear at the moment, however, the SAPS is working to uncover the circumstances surrounding the incident,” Ndubane said.
Members of the public are urged to come forward with any information that will assist in the arrest of the suspects.
